English
Noun
crew-served weapon (plural crew-served weapons)
- (military, notably USMC) Any weapon system that requires a crew or more than one individual to function due to its high operational complexity.
A heavy machine gun, anti-materiel rifle, or rocket launcher might be a crew-served weapon.
